Trevor Francis
Trevor Francis said his much-publicised spat with Alex Kolinko has been settled amicably and it's the press who won't let the matter lie.
He added that the incident should prove to supporters how passionate he is about Palace.
He told the Croydon Guardian: "Really the press have continued to write about it, not through the chairman or myself but mainly through Alex and more so his agent.
"I had a long discussion with Alex after the game and a meeting with the chairman, so it was all done very amicably internally.
"By training at 10 o'clock on Thursday morning, everything that needed to be done had been done.
"I have had many Palace supporters showing support for me over what happened. I think they fully realise now that they have a manager who's got Palace in his heart.
"I am a fierce competitor and that I am very passionate towards my football team. I think one or two supporters have now changed their opinion of me as a manager."
